Global Gas Detection Equipment Market Overview


Gas Detection Equipment Market Size was valued at USD 5,632.0 million in 2024. Gas Detection Equipment Market industry is projected to grow from USD 5,846.0 Million in 2025 to USD 9,190,5 million by 2035, exhibiting a compound annual growth rate (CAGR) of 4.63% during the forecast period (2025 - 2035). Gas Detection Equipment Market Opportunity


Demand For Enviormental Monitoring


The gas detection equipment market is experiencing A significant growth due to growing environmental concerns and industry safety regulations gas detection equipment plays a vital role in detecting and analysing the hazardous gas present in any environment across various industries. Among these environmental monitoring has become a growing concern due to the rising need for pollution control, air quality management and emission norms. As industries tries to meet the environmental standards the demand for advanced gas detection systems have seen a significant surge.

The rapid growth in population, industrial emissions and garbage waste are the key contributors of pollutants in the environment which can lead to rapid deterioration of environment. The different types of combustible, toxic and health hazardous materials used at the industrial setting is well known to be the key contributor of pollutants it is important to monitor the type and concentration of this pollutants releasing in the environment daily to avoid accidents and mishaps. There is a rise for gas detection equipment across various industries to increase workplace safety and occupational health this can mainly be seen sign in industries like processing and manufacturing.

Environmental monitoring in industries is growing has government worldwide are introducing stronger environmental regulations to limit the harmful emissions. Regulatory framework like the European Union’s emission directive and Clean Air Act have compelled industries to adopt various gas detection equipment’s to monitor their air quality and minimise the levels of toxic emissions. This has Led to many equipment manufacturers offering innovative monitoring systems.

Gas Detection Equipment Technology Insights


Based on Technology, the Gas Detection Equipment Market is segmented into Semiconductor, Infrared (IR), Laser-based Detection, Laser-based Detection, Catalytic Photoionization Detector (PID), and Others. The Semiconductor segment dominated the global market in 2023, while the Photoionization Detector (PID) Compounds is projected to be the fastest–growing segment during the forecast period. Semiconductor gas detectors operate by identifying changes in the resistance of semiconductor materials when they encounter specific gases.

This detection approach is particularly effective for recognizing low-concentration gases, rendering these detectors appropriate for uses such as confined space surveillance and leak detection. Sectors like automotive and food processing gain from the sensitivity provided by semiconductor detectors. The semiconductor sensing components, usually comprised of metal oxides like tin dioxide (SnO2) or tungsten trioxide (WO3), engage in chemical reactions with target gases on their surfaces, leading to measurable electrical alterations. These detectors are adept at sensing gases such as hydrogen sulfide (H2S), carbon monoxide (CO), and volatile organic compounds (VOCs) at parts per million (ppm) levels.

However, their performance may be influenced by temperature fluctuations and cross-sensitivity to other gases, potentially diminishing their efficacy in specific environments. To address these issues, contemporary semiconductor detectors frequently integrate temperature compensation mechanisms and selective filtering technologies. Despite these limitations, semiconductor gas detectors continue to be an invaluable asset in situations where the detection of minute gas concentrations is vital, especially in industrial hygiene monitoring and environmental conservation contexts.


Gas Detection Equipment Product Insights


Based on the By Product Type the Gas Detection Equipment Market is segmented into Fixed Gas Detectors, Portable Gas Detectors, Flame Detectors. The Portable Gas Detectors segment dominated the global market in 2023, while the Portable Gas Detectors is projected to be the fastest–growing segment during the forecast period. Portable gas detectors are handheld instruments intended for individual use, allowing for real-time tracking of gas levels in diverse surroundings. Their convenience and user-friendliness make them essential in fields like construction, firefighting, and emergency response.

These detectors play a vital role in safeguarding the wellbeing of individuals operating in confined areas or places with significant gas exposure hazards. Portable gas detectors are employed for a variety of uses, including personal safety monitoring, leak detection, and environmental evaluations. In the oil and gas sector, for example, laborers often come across volatile organic compounds and additional dangerous gases, rendering portable detectors critical for upholding safety standards. These tools enable workers to monitor gas levels in real-time and react promptly to potential dangers, thus minimizing the likelihood of accidents and health problems.


Gas Detection Equipment Application Insights


Based on the By Product Type the Gas Detection Equipment Market is segmented into Oil & Gas, Mining, Petrochemicals, Construction, Energy & Power, Water Treatment, Industrial, Automotive, Others. The Oil & Gas  segment dominated the global market in 2023, while the Automotive is projected to be the fastest–growing segment during the forecast period. Gas detection is vital in the oil and gas industry, covering upstream exploration, midstream transportation, and downstream refining. The main importance of gas detection in this field lies in its capacity to offer early warning of leaks, thus protecting personnel and reducing environmental impact.

Upstream operations consist of the exploration and extraction of oil and gas, where flammable gases such as methane and hydrogen sulfide are frequently encountered. Midstream activities involve transportation and storage, where gas detection systems oversee pipelines and storage facilities for leaks. Downstream operations concentrate on refining and distribution, where it is essential to detect volatile organic compounds (VOCs) and other hazardous gases.


Gas Detection Equipment Regional Insights


Based on the Region, the report on the Gas Detection Equipment Market has been segmented into North America, South America, Europe, APAC, MEA. The market for gas detection equipment in North America is experiencing consistent growth, fueled by strict safety regulations, heightened industrial activities, and growing awareness about workplace safety.

The area, spearheaded by the United States and Canada, possesses a solid regulatory framework, encompassing OSHA (Occupational Safety and Health Administration), EPA (Environmental Protection Agency), and NFPA (National Fire Protection Association) standards, which require the implementation of gas detection systems in various sectors including oil & gas, chemicals, mining, healthcare, and manufacturing. These regulations are essential for market growth, since industries emphasize adherence and the safety of workers.


The market for gas detection equipment in South America is experiencing consistent growth, fueled by rising industrialization, strict safety regulations, and an increasing focus on workplace safety. Nations like Brazil, Argentina, and Chile play vital roles in the market, mainly because of their growing oil & gas, mining, and chemical sectors.

The growing worries about air quality and dangerous gas leaks have increased the need for state-of-the-art gas detection technologies. The oil and gas industry continues to be a major influence, considering South America's extensive hydrocarbon reserves and active exploration efforts.


Gas detection systems are essential in multiple industries, such as oil & gas, chemicals, manufacturing, and mining, guaranteeing prompt identification of dangerous gases to avert accidents and maintain worker safety. The Gas Detection Equipment Market in Europe is witnessing consistent growth, propelled by strict environmental regulations, workplace safety requirements, and rising industrialization The regulatory environment in Europe significantly influences market demand. Organizations like the European Environment Agency (EEA) and the Occupational Safety and Health Administration (OSHA) implement rigorous air quality and workplace safety regulations, pressuring companies to embrace innovative gas detection technologies.

The ATEX (Atmosphères Explosibles) Directive requires explosion-proof equipment in dangerous zones, thereby increasing the need for gas detectors in sectors managing flammable materials. According to the BP Statistical Review of World Energy 2022, the European Union is the world's second-largest producer of petroleum products. In 2021, it had a crude oil refining capacity of about 13 million barrels per day, which represented 16% of the total global capacity.

Gas Detection Equipment Market Industry Developments


February 2025: Teledyne Gas & Flame Detection (Teledyne GFD) introduced the Spyglass™ Xtend, a triple-infrared flame detector capable of detecting both hydrogen (Hâ‚‚) and hydrocarbon (HC) fires simultaneously. This enhances industrial safety by identifying fires that Hâ‚‚-only detectors might miss, preventing potential hydrocarbon fuel-related hazards.
